Extension Usage Instructions

                        The Newsroom Beta Plugin provides real-time insights on the trustworthiness of the news you see online, in a fully transparent way. 

You will understand exactly what elements our tech took into account to make each assessment, as The Newsroom uses explainable Artificial Intelligence technology to assess the trustworthiness of articles and sources.
